A block of mass m rests on a rough horizontl surface as shown in figure (a) and (b). Coefficient of friciton between block and surface is `mu`. A force F-mg acting at an angle `theta` with the vertical side of the block. Find the condition for which block will move along the surface.

For(a): normal reaction `N=mg-mg cos theta` fricitional force `=muN=mu(mg-mg cos theta)`
Now block can be pulled when : Horizontal component of force `ge` fricitional force i.e. `mg sin theta gemu(mg-mg cos theta)`
or `2 sin (theta)/(2)cos (theta)/(2)gemu(1-cos theta)`
or `2sin(theta)/(2)cos (theta)/(2)ge2musin^(2)(theta)/(2)` or `cot(theta)/(2)gemu`
For (b): Normal reaction `N=mg+mg cos theta=mg(1+cos theta)` Hence, block can be pushed along the horizontal surface when horizontal component of force `ge` fricitional force
i.e. `mg sin thetagemu mg(1+cos theta)` or
`2 sin(theta)/(2)cos (theta)/(2gemuxx2 cos^(2)(theta)/(2)rArrtan(theta)/(2)gemu`
